Crispy Air Fryer Onion Rings with Smoky Paprika
These air fryer onion rings are a healthier and incredibly crispy alternative to deep-fried versions. With a subtly smoky flavor and baked to a golden brown, they are the perfect snack or an ideal side dish.

Ingredients
for 4 servingsAmounts are automatically adjusted.
- 2 mediumlarge onions
- 120 gall-purpose flour
- 60 gcornstarch
- 1 tspsmoked paprika
- 0.5 tspgarlic powder
- 0.5 tsponion powder
- 1 Pinchsalt(to taste)
- 1 Pinchblack pepper(to taste)
- 200 mlcold sparkling water
- 100 gPanko breadcrumbs
- 2 tbspvegetable oil
Instructions
Peel the onions and slice them into 1 cm (0.4 inch) thick rings. Separate the rings and set them aside.
In a shallow bowl, combine the all-purpose flour, cornstarch, smoked paprika,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and black pepper. Whisk well.
Gradually add the cold sparkling water to the dry ingredients, whisking until you have a smooth, thin batter. Make sure there are no lumps.
In another shallow bowl, place the Panko breadcrumbs.
Dip each onion ring first into the batter, ensuring it's fully coated, then transfer it to the Panko breadcrumbs. Press the breadcrumbs gently onto the onion ring to ensure it's well covered.
Preheat your air fryer to 200°C (390°F). Lightly spray the air fryer basket with vegetable oil.
Arrange the breaded onion rings in a single layer in the air fryer basket, making sure not to overcrowd it. You will likely need to cook them in batches.
Lightly spray the top of the onion rings with vegetable oil. Air fry for 10-15 minutes, flipping them halfway through, until golden brown and crispy. Cooking time may vary depending on your air fryer model.
Remove the crispy onion rings from the air fryer and serve immediately with your favorite dipping sauce.

Varianten
- Add a pinch of cayenne pepper to the batter for a spicy kick.
- Experiment with different spices in the batter, such as chili powder or cumin.
Ersatz & Alternativen
- For a gluten-free version, use gluten-free all-purpose flour and gluten-free Panko breadcrumbs.
- Any neutral-flavored oil can be used instead of vegetable oil for spraying.
Aufbewahrung
Store leftover onion rings in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2 days. Reheat in the air fryer at 180°C (350°F) for 5-7 minutes until crispy again.
Einfrieren
To freeze, arrange cooked and cooled onion rings in a single layer on a baking sheet and freeze until solid. Transfer to a freezer-safe bag for up to 1 month. Reheat from frozen in the air fryer.
